Forklift Truck Classification
For little under a century, the forklift truck has been working its magic. Even today, this particular kind of machine is found in each and every warehouse operation all over the world.

Because of WWI, there were shortages of manpower that ed to the creation of the first forklifts. Companies like Yale & Town and Clark introduced the material handling equipment which used powered lift tractors in their factories. In 1918, Clark saw the potential for these machinery and began selling them.

From a simple tractor with an attachment, the forklift design evolved in the 1920s, to a dedicated equipment equipped with a vertical lifting mast. The forklift developed and became more advanced with the Second World War. The forklift played an important part during this time in the handling of supplies for various armies all around the globe. It was also during this time that wooden pallets were introduced which proved the need for the lift truck in the material handling industry.

Forklifts gained momentum and continued to develop when World War II ended. In the 1950s, forklifts that utilize batteries made an appearance. There were other more specialized forklift models introduced such as the Narrow Aisle Reach truck. This model was made by the Raymond Corporation. In the 1960s and 1970s, improvements were made within the electronic controls area. This made forklifts much more versatile and companies were able to look at warehouse efficiency.

These days, the forklift can be powered by numerous fuel options such as electric battery, diesel, gasoline, CNG or compressed natural gas, LPG or liquid propane gas. The first hybrid forklift was developed by Mitsubishi. It currently runs on lithium ion and diesel battery. This kind consumes 39% less fuel compared to existing models. Statistics prove that its carbon dioxide emissions are about 14.6 tons less than those forklift models which are powered by internal combustion or IC engines.
